#5 England's loss to Bangladesh that saw them exit the World Cup 2015 in the group stage

Rubel Hossain celebrating Ian Bell's wicket

England's mediocre limited overs performances, a by-product of their insipid and outdated approach towards the format reached its nadir in the 2015 World Cup played across the Trans-Tasman. That the English think-tank was in shambles going into the World Cup was testified by the absurd sacking of the skipper Alastair Cook both from the position that he beheld and from the team, a month before the marquee event. But even the ardent critics of English ODI set-up would have expected the team to get past the group stages at least. They were in for a shock of their lives as England capitulated against a rejuvenated Bangladesh and were subsequently knocked out of the event before the quarter-final stages.

However, the painful loss serves as the much-needed fillip for English cricket. Post the World Cup, England have adopted an aggressive brand of play that has seen them post 300+ totals frequently and have earmarked themselves a team for higher honours with the next World Cup to be held on their shores come 2019 and erase the blemishes of the past.
